Transaction

30eb6afd51cab7e3db1bc0cd9a6028ea2fb05a67c87016efeb496b83daefd0a2
538,221 confirmations
Timestamp
1457175502
Block401,262
Fee27,571 sats
Fee rate48.8 sats/vB
view on mempool.space

Inputs & Outputs